Monday 13th August 2012
Meteosat MSG satellite picture from Ferdinand Valk’s site at 12.00 UTC http://www.fvalk.com/images/Day_image/MSG-1200-EUR.jpg Meteosat MSG-2 satellite picture from Bernard Burton’s site at 12.00 UTC http://www.woksat.info/etcuh13m/uh13-msg-1200-uk.html NOAA 19 satellite picture from Bernard Burton’s site at 12.12 UTC http://www.woksat.info/etcuh13/uh13-1212-b-uk.html Eumetsat Animation from the Norwegian Weather Service http://www.yr.no/satellitt/europa_animasjon.html UK min. temps on Sunday night http://tinyurl.com/6ws96z7 Little Rissington, Benson, Herstmonceux and Andrewsfield 13.1°C, Fair Isle and Bingley 12.7°C, Kirkwall and Spadeadam 12.6°C, Lerwick 12.4°C, Loch Glascarnoch, Copley and Charlwood 12.3°C, Shap 12.0°C, Glen Ogle 11.3°C, Baltasound 11.1°C. Crosby and Jersey Airport 16.5°C, Exeter Airport and Chivenor 16.7°C, St Athan 16.8°C, Mumbles and Solent MRSC 16.9°C, St Helier (Jersey) 17.1°C. UK max. temps on Monday http://tinyurl.com/8ygebdb Glen Ogle 14.7°C, Inverbervie 14.9°C, Fair Isle 15.6°C, Wick 15.8°C, Lerwick 16.9°C, Baltasound 17.0°C. Leconfield and Holbeach 23.2°C, Scampton and Gravesend (Broadness) 23.3°C, Weybourne and Northolt 23.6°C, Heathrow 23.8°C, Cranwell and Marham 23.9°C, London St James’s Park 24.0°C, Coningsby 24.2°C. OGIMET summary http://tinyurl.com/cuygq3h Rainfall radar http://www.meteox.com/h.aspx?r=&soort=loop24uur&URL or http://www.raintoday.co.uk/ Rainfall totals in 24 hours ending 18.00 UTC on Monday http://tinyurl.com/7lm37mw Cardinham 8 mm, Ballypatrick, Port Ellen (Islay) and West Freugh 9 mm, Bournemouth (Hurn) 10 mm, Portglenone 12 mm, St Angelo and Ronaldsway 13 mm, Machrihanish 15 mm, Castlederg 19 mm, Lough Fea 34 mm.
